Transaction 9309e3afcfea6cc9b0a79fc31a2e5292a4e5e79da8a401ef3853970933d8b83e

1 Input
2 Outputs
  • 9309e3afcfea6cc9b0a79fc31a2e5292a4e5e79da8a401ef3853970933d8b83e:0
  • value  53593
    address  3Hf92FMe7EWiZM8Q2maWyFiqgP2CwLipTd
  • 9309e3afcfea6cc9b0a79fc31a2e5292a4e5e79da8a401ef3853970933d8b83e:1
  • value  5277580
    address  368AK1tw5eoRMRAAsKKKsYPwUVnVyWWPLU